Background
LMAX Group is a FinTech company that designs, develops, builds and runs leading edge financial exchanges in major financial centres around the world, specialising in fiat and crypto-currencies.
We want an energetic and passionate engineer to bring new skills and perspectives to complement our Technical Operations department. We are made up of Systems, Networks and Security Specialists whose job is to build and maintain LMAX's infrastructure, enforce regulatory compliance, and provide a stable platform for our state-of-the-art trading engine.
The range of responsibility for our team is broad: from tuning operating systems to cloud automation, from packets on a wire to global connectivity, from Python scripting to large analytical simulations. We’re given high level milestones and the freedom to discuss, design, and deliver platforms upon which our entire business operates.
Senior Engineers drive improvements and change in a culture of personal responsibility and autonomy. Senior Engineers are key to delivery through automation, providing direction on how milestones are delivered, and providing input into future roadmaps.
This role is the first Systems Engineer position based in our New York Office. You would be expected to visit our New York data centre from time to time. There may also be a minor amount of desktop support and Windows in this office, when the global Windows team isn’t able to cover.
